German Monks Create World's 1st Powdered Beer

A monastic brewery near Munich says it has created the first powdered beer. Just add water, and it will froth up, complete with a foamy head and full flavor.

The result promises massive savings on transport, because it can be shipped at 10% of the weight, Loz Blain reported for New Atlas.

Klosterbrauerei Neuzelle worked together with "technology partners" and used funding from BMWi to create its first powdered product, a dextrin-rich zero-alcohol beer brewed using conventional methods, then "processed and prepared into a water-soluble beer powder/granulate."

"The time is ripe to put classic beer production and logistics to the test in view of the way we treat our environment," says major Neuzelle shareholder Helmut Fritsche.


“Billions of liters of water are transported to consumers worldwide, because beer consists of up to 90% water. From an environmental point of view, we are already saving on transport, but not yet on the use of resources and the costs of production.”
